Viewing Hardware: Power Supply Details for
Datacenters and Clusters
View the virtual power supply details for a datacenter or cluster on the Dell Datacenter or Cluster Information tab. For
information to appear on this page, you must run an inventory job. Datacenter and cluster pages let you export
information to a CSV file and offers filter/search functionality on the data grid. Hardware views are directly reporting the
data from OMSA and iDRAC. See Running an Inventory Job Now.
1. In VMware vCenter, in the Navigator, click vCenter.
2. Click Datacenters or Clusters.
3. On the Objects tab, select the specific datacenter or cluster for which you want to view Hardware: Power Supply
details.
4. On the Monitor tab, select the Dell Datacenter/Cluster Information tab, and on the Hardware: Power Supply sub-
tab, view the following:
Host Displays the name of the host.
Service Tag Displays the Service Tag.
Type Displays the type of power supply. Power supply types include:
– UNKNOWN
– LINEAR
– SWITCHING
– BATTERY
– UPS
– CONVERTER
– REGULATOR
– AC
– DC
– VRM
Location Displays the location of the power supply, such as Slot 1.
Output (Watts) Displays the power in Watts.
Status Displays the status of the power supply. The status options include:
– OTHER
– UNKNOWN
– OK
– CRITICAL
– NOT CRITICAL
– RECOVERABLE
